Engine Components and Common Issues

Knowledge of your car's mechanical components is essential for ensuring peak performance and avoiding expensive maintenance issues. Let's explore essential engine elements and frequent concerns.

The engine block is vital as it contains the cylinders where the combustion process takes place. These cylindrical pistons transform fuel energy to mechanical force. The crankshaft then changes this linear motion into rotating energy, driving your vehicle forward.

The valvetrain is crucial in regulating the timing of air and fuel intake and managing exhaust gas release. This incorporates a sophisticated arrangement of valves, springs, and camshafts, keeping your engine running smoothly.

Typical engine issues can appear in various ways. Difficulty starting often suggest problems with electrical or fuel systems—inspect the starter motor, fuel pump, and battery.

Operating problems like irregular operation or misfires may be caused by damaged oxygen sensors, worn spark plugs, or clogged fuel injectors.

Excessive heat is a common problem, generally due to malfunctioning thermostats, failing water pumps, or coolant leaks. Watch out for warning signs like unusual noises or physical signs such as excessive exhaust smoke.

Regular maintenance, including timely oil changes and air filter replacements, is crucial for stopping these concerns.

Understanding Transmission and Drivetrain

Mastering the fundamentals of your vehicle's transmission and drivetrain is crucial to maintaining smooth power delivery and total performance. The powertrain, encompassing both engine and drivetrain, converts the engine's raw power into controlled movement.

At the heart of this system, the transmission regulates power delivery, adjusting two main types: stick shift, demanding clutch and gear input, and automatic, which autonomously manages gear changes via hydraulic systems.

When considering automatic transmissions, the torque converter plays a critical role by linking the engine to the transmission. It improves torque output through fluid coupling, guaranteeing energy is transferred efficiently.

The driveshaft, constructed from strong materials like steel or aluminum, transfers rotational force from the transmission to the differential, utilizing constant-velocity joints for smooth operation.

Comprehending the differential is essential; it permits wheels to rotate at different speeds during turns, preserving power delivery, specifically in vehicles with multiple driven wheels.

Axles join the wheels to the differential, changing in configuration based on vehicle design.

To ensure peak performance, periodic upkeep and checking of these components are essential, enhancing fuel efficiency and avoiding costly repairs.

Essential Brake Care Guide

Navigating the intricate world of brake system maintenance guarantees both reliable operation on the road. Your vehicle's brake system is an intricate collection of parts including brake pads, rotors, calipers, brake lines, and fluid. Every element requires regular maintenance for peak functionality.

Periodic examinations, preferably conducted yearly or more often depending on your driving conditions, are vital for early problem detection.

Brake fluid maintenance is essential as it attracts moisture, resulting in reduced efficiency and corrosion. Change it every 24-36 months or 30K miles. Likewise, keep track of brake pads—they wear down naturally and typically should be replaced between 25K and 70K miles.

Be alert to warning signs like abnormal noises—like squealing, grinding, or metal-on-metal sounds—and physical indicators such as a soft brake pedal, car drifting to one side, pedal vibrations, or longer stopping distances. These signals need prompt service from a professional technician.

Routine upkeep involves monthly brake fluid inspections and pad thickness assessments. Moreover, maintain smooth braking techniques and avoid riding the brakes.

Understanding ASE Certification

Finding a professional auto repair shop can be overwhelming, but being familiar with ASE certification makes easier your decision. ASE certification, granted by the National Institute for Automotive Service Excellence, is the automotive industry's gold standard for technical proficiency.

When choosing a shop, look for the blue ASE seal and technicians wearing ASE patches. These indicators demonstrate that the technicians have met demanding standards through thorough testing in particular areas like electrical systems, engine repair, and brake service.

Technicians earn ASE certification by fulfilling two years of practical experience or pairing one year of experience with a two-year automotive degree, followed by passing specialized exams. To keep certification, they must recertify every five years, ensuring they keep pace with the latest automotive technology.

This devotion to ongoing education assures that certified technicians are able to competently identify and resolve modern vehicles' complex systems.

Master ASE Certification takes it a step further, calling for technicians to succeed in multiple tests across different specialties, showing their complete expertise.

Essential Care Guidelines

The lifespan of your vehicle can be greatly increased through a carefully structured service routine.

Begin with scheduled service intervals between 5,000 and 8,000 miles or about every six months. Regular servicing encompasses changing oils and filters, checking fluid levels, wheel position changes, and basic inspections.

When reaching 15,000 miles, perform intermediate services with comprehensive vehicle checks and change transmission fluid and air filters. Upon reaching 30,000 miles, perform major services like changing brake fluid and spark plugs, along with replacing differential oil and cabin filters.

Proper fluid care is crucial. Regularly change engine oil every 5,000 to 8,000 miles.

Replace transmission fluid at 30,000-mile intervals to maintain performance. Change brake fluid at two-year or 25,000-mile intervals, and replace coolant at two-year or 30,000-mile intervals to avoid overheating.

Adhere to filter maintenance schedules: Engine air filters every 15,000 miles and cabin air filters every 30,000 miles.

Change oil filters with each oil service.

For tire care, change tire positions every 5,000 to 8,000 miles, verify alignment yearly, and check tire pressure every month.

Frequently check battery connections for oxidation, monitor performance, and ensure terminal cleanliness to maintain consistent function.

Understanding Your Consumer Rights

Steering through the world of auto repairs can be challenging, but understanding your consumer rights makes certain you're protected. Auto repair laws compel shops to furnish written estimates for repairs over $100, requiring your authorization before extra work. They can't legally exceed the estimated costs by more than 10% without your explicit consent.

Be sure to verify your rights shown prominently at the shop, including your ability to inspect replaced parts and check your vehicle before payment.

Service guarantees are essential. Repair shops are required to extend a minimum three-month or 3,000-mile warranty on repairs and parts unless explicitly noted differently. Verify the warranty terms are recorded, detailing warranty scope, duration, and claim procedures.

If conflicts emerge, initiate direct communication—file a complaint and demand a response within 14 days. If not settled, explore alternative dispute resolutions like the BBB AUTO LINE or state agencies. Legal action is your last resort.

Don't hesitate to obtain a second opinion. Compare shop quotes, warranties, and certifications. Verify the shop's history with issues to ensure quality assurance.

How Do I Maximize My Vehicle Battery's Longevity?

To prolong your automobile's battery life, routinely inspect and maintain contact points, ensure it's firmly mounted, reduce frequent short trips, and test its charge. Keep ideal charge levels and think about using a battery maintainer when parked.

What Are the Signs of a Failing Transmission?

You're noticing a failing transmission when you notice delayed or rough gear shifts, strange noises, transmission fluid leaks, or a burning smell. Monitor warning lights and irregular RPMs for verification of transmission problems.

What's the Best Way to Select the Right Oil for My Car?

Review your car's manual for oil requirements. Think about your driving conditions and climate. Choose oil with the right viscosity and API rating. Speak with a professional if unsure. Periodically check oil levels and replace it as recommended.

What's the Right Time to Replace My Car's Timing Belt?

Check your car's manual for specific timing belt replacement intervals, usually every 60,000 to 100,000 miles. Look for signs like unusual sounds or starting problems. Don't delay replacement to prevent engine damage or major repairs.

What Steps Should I Take for Troubleshooting a Car's Electrical Concern?

Begin by testing the battery and fuses for problems. Utilize a multimeter to check voltage and continuity. Examine wiring for damage. Reference the vehicle's manual for specific electrical components and analyze each circuit systematically for issues.
